Tips for Getting the Best Vectorization Results
- Use high contrast — Dark lines on a white background produce the best results. If photographing a sketch, make sure the lighting is even and the background is clean.
- Keep lines clear — The AI can handle rough sketches, but cleaner input produces cleaner output. Use a thick marker or dark pencil for best definition.
- One subject per image — For logos and icons, isolate the design in the frame. Avoid cluttered backgrounds or multiple overlapping drawings.
- Try different styles — Experiment with different sketch styles. The AI adapts to minimalist line drawings, detailed illustrations, and everything in between.
